What year did Alan Shepard go into space?

Alan Shepard's first flight was on May 5, 1961. It was the first spaceflight by an American. Yuri Gagarin of the USSR went into space 3 weeks before Shepard to become the first man in space. Shepard's second flight was aboard Apollo 14. He and his crewmates, Stuart Roosa and Edgar Mitchell were launched toward the moon on January 31, 1971. On February 5, Shepard piloted the lunar module "Antares" to the most accurate landing of all the Apollo moon landings. 33 hours after landing, Shepard and Mitchell left the lunar surface. They landed in the Pacific Ocean on February 9, 1971. Shepard was the oldest astronaut to land on the moon and the only one of the Original 7 to do so. Shepard died on July 21, 1998. Because he was a former Navy avaitor, he requested that his ashes be scattered at sea.

What did Alan Shepard do?

Second Man in Space and Lunar GolferAlan Shepard (1923-1998) was a US astronaut and a CDR (later RADM) in the US Navy. He was the first American into space, and the second man in space after Yuri Gagarin of the USSR. He later became the fifth man to walk on the surface of the Moon, and the first man to hit a golf ball on the Moon.On May 5, 1961, Shepard flew his Freedom 7 capsule on a sub-orbital space flight as part of the Mercury program. On February 5, 1971, Shepard and fellow Apollo 14 astronaut Ed Mitchell became the 5th and 6th men to walk on the Moon. The reason for the 10-year interval between his missions is that he was treated for an inner-ear condition.
